Abstract :
Conduct bridge type adaptability research in national scope, based on this, construct the highway bridge type adaptability database system [1], and put forward the bridge type adaptability evaluation method, evaluation index and its value based on the typical bridge comprehensive performance. On the foundation of the database system and bridge adaptability index, establish the bridge type selection analysis model based on the analytic hierarchy process and fuzzy mathematics theory, then depend on this, conduct comparison and selection analysis on the new bridge type sample and form the bridge type selection key technology [2].
